After leaving four or five messages without receiving a response, you should stop calling – at least for now. Don't expect the courtesy of a call back from a hiring authority. Unless they have a need for someone like you, it is not likely that they will call you back. Don't take it personally. Sticking with our "Andy Applicant" example, if Andy had left Hannah Hiring Manager a voicemail of, “It’s me and I would like to talk to you.” She will not know who Andy is nor what Andy wants to talk about. Effectively she will be answering Andy’s questions on the spot the whole time after she figures out how to get in touch with him. What if she forgets to mention something?
Note: There is never a reason to give your sales pitch on voice mail. No one is there to say yes. Your objective is to make contact. Your objective is to provide enough information to create positive response.
